  • Title

    Current-mode control of the step-down capacitor-coupled converter (C3) for traction application

  • Abstract
    This paper presents a current-mode control method of the step-down capacitor-coupled converter (C3). Two different bang-bang operating principle of inductor current and the suitable control scheme of output voltage under two load states, motoring and generating, are discussed. The operation of the converter is proved, by simulation results
